Mark Twain Early Learning Center

705 S 31st St
Saint Joseph, MO 64507
Mark Twain Early Learning Center serves 195 students in grades Prekindergarten. 
The student-teacher ratio of 12:1 is equal to the Missouri state level of 12:1.
Minority enrollment is 47%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Missouri state average of 32% (majority Black and Hispanic).
